Step 2Collecting the parts
1) a base - I used a scrap piece of 2x8 about a foot and bit long
2) a rotating part - I used a scrap of plywood about two feet long (3/8" thick)
3) a stationary part - I used 3/4" plywood for this
4) fasteners - I used drywall/wood screws (screwdriver required)
5) spacers - round plastic/wood/metal tubes of appropriate dimension*
6) a saw - for cutting the wood (preferable a jig, scroll or coping saw)
7) bending springs - these are optional
* Appropriate dimension is approximately any dimension. If you are looking for the absolute minimum (i.e. tightest turn) I suggest picking something as close as possible to the size of the tube or wire without being smaller.
